How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Elizabethvle?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Elizabethvle Studio Apartments | $1,247 | $933 | $1,508 |
Elizabethvle 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,341 | $782 | $2,771 |
Elizabethvle 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,585 | $1,095 | $3,181 |
Elizabethvle 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,082 | $1,568 | $2,703 |
Elizabethvle 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,524 | $2,274 | $2,724 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Elizabethvle
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Elizabethvle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Elizabethvle ranges from $782 to $2,771 with an average monthly rent of $1,341.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Elizabethvle c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Elizabethvle range from $1,095 to $3,181.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,585.
How expensive are Elizabethvle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 18 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Elizabethvle on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,568 to $2,703 - averaging $2,082 for the location.
